The Public Programs Officer is responsible for contributing to the overall visitor experience development of the Discovery Zone, including; storyline, themes and collections and multimedia to engage broad audiences. The Public Programs Officer is responsible for contributing to the research, development and delivery of, learning programs to children and their families as well as onsite school-aged audiences. . The Public Programs Officer, taking guidance from the Public Programs Manager, will ensure all programs remain relevant to the Memorial’s strategic vision: To be recognised globally as one of the finest national memorials of its kind, providing meaningful experiences through commemoration and authentic and engaging storytelling.

The Public Programs Officer works closely with the Public Programs Manager and Curator, in the delivery of the gallery development vision. The work involves the development and implementation of the Discovery Zone, associated programs and operational procedures.

The position will contribute to the stakeholder consultation strategy and will be responsible for assisting the administration of stakeholder activities identified in the engagement plan. This position will be responsible for collaborating with consultants, and contractors involved in content development and multimedia delivery.

The Public Programs Officer will be accountable to the Gallery Development management team, Advisory Groups and key stakeholders. The position works collaboratively with the Gallery Development Team led by the Executive Program Director.
